Reckless Driver Causes Crash In Rockland, Send Pregnant Woman To Hospital, Police Say A pregnant woman was hospitalized following a crash between an SUV and a bucket truck on I-87 in Rockland.  The crash took place around 2:48 p.m., Wednesday, Oct. 23, near the Palisades exit when the bucket truck swerved to avoid another vehicle that was driving erratically and cut him off, said New York State Police Trooper Tara McCormick. When the truck swerved, he struck a Chrysler Pacifica before overturning, she added. A pregnant passenger of the Chrysler was transported for a precautionary check-up, McCormick said.  No other injuries were reported.

Driver Busted For Doing 'Donuts' In Roadway A 28-year-old West Haven man was arrested or driving while intoxicated after he was caught doing "donuts" in the roadway with his vehicle. Joshua Lublin, was arrested around 9:30 p.m., Sunday, Oct. 20, when Milford police responded to a call for an “erratic driver," said Milford Police Officer Mike Devito. Police responded to the area and located Lublin, who later failed a field sobriety test, Devito said. He was charged with DWI and released on a $500 bond. Lublin is scheduled to appear in court on Nov. 14.
